For architects and interior designers, polyurethane material allows these heavy, intricate classic designs to be easily applied without adding static load to buildings. Extremely lightweight compared to traditional materials like plaster or marble, Polure column and arch models stand out with their quick installation and high impact resistance. Moisture-resistant and easy to paint, this product line offers long-lasting decoration solutions, especially for hotel lobbies, wedding venues, and prestigious residential projects.
